Wall-E is the definition of fun-sized! At just 29 pounds and 3 years old, this tiny little beefcake has the biggest personality packed into one adorable body. We think he may be some kind of Staffy/Lab mix, but rescue genetics love to keep us guessing. What we do know is that he is ridiculously cute, has the coolest unique coat, and absolutely adores people.
The second someone walks into the room, Wall-E acts like they’re his long-lost best friend. Full body wiggles, happy little dances, climbing into laps, soaking up pets, this boy is pure joy. He truly knows no strangers and would happily spend all day getting attention from anyone willing to tell him how handsome he is. He’s playful, affectionate, goofy, and the perfect little sidekick size for adventures, car rides, patio days, and running errands with his humans.

Wall-E had so much fun meeting people during his time with us and showed us over and over how loving and social he is. Once he warms up, he becomes everyone’s tiny shadow. He loves to run around, explore, and be part of whatever is going on.
When it comes to other dogs, Wall-E is honestly just a goofy guy who has absolutely no idea what personal space is. He wants to play SO badly, but sometimes his excitement completely takes over his tiny little body and brain. He tends to come in way too enthusiastic, immediately trying to wrestle, climb, or awkwardly mount dogs because he simply hasn’t learned appropriate dog manners yet. Even when bigger dogs try to say, “Hey buddy, chill out,” Wall-E can get overly excited and feed off the chaos instead of taking the hint.
It’s important to know this behavior is not coming from aggression — he truly just seems like a socially awkward little dude who never got the memo on how to properly dog. Because of this, Wall-E would do best as the only dog in the home right now while he continues learning confidence, boundaries, and calmer social skills. He’s much happier focusing on his people instead of trying to figure out dog politics. He’s also probably not the best candidate for dog parks or super dog-heavy environments.
Wall-E can also get a little talkative on leash when he sees other dogs, so he’d thrive most in a home with a yard where he can zoom around comfortably. A quieter neighborhood or more suburban/rural lifestyle would likely help him feel successful.
As for cats, Wall-E actually did pretty well! He showed some curiosity but was overall fairly aloof and respectful. We think he could potentially live with calm, dog-savvy cats with slow introductions, though an overnight cat test would still be recommended.

We facilitate adoptions nationwide using our rescue run USDA certified transport system, ensuring every pet travels safely and comfortably with 24/7 care. Our transport includes drop off locations, in WA, UT, OR, ID, VA, PA, OH, NY, CT, VT, TN, KY, WI, MN, IL, WI and Canada (pick up in Bellingham, WA, Buffalo, NY or Brattleboro, VT for for Canadian adopters). You will have the opportunity to track their journey in real time, see photo updates, learn fun facts, connect with fellow adopters and fosters through our private Facebook event page!
Before the adoption is finalized, you will meet your pet through a video call, creating a fun and personalized experience!
The adoption fee is $1000 and includes all vetting (DAPP with booster, Bordetella, Rabies vaccine, multiple broad spectrum deworming treatments, spay/neuter, flea prevention, a 12 month heartworm preventative injectable, heartworm test and treatment if needed, a microchip with free lifetime registration, a high quality nylon Martingale collar, a health certificate deeming the pup healthy for travel, cost of transport*, and priceless years of love and loyal companionship!

At our 2 acre Texas based property, we assess every animal with trainers on staff, we modify behavior as needed, and create individualized behavior plans to help prepare dogs for their future families including crate training, potty training, leash walking, etc. Our fosters are able to attend group training and socialization play groups helping them stay confident, well rounded, and adoption-ready. Our on-site trainers are dedicated to each dog’s growth and we enjoy seeing their progress!
We go above and beyond to ensure every animal receives exceptional care. Veterinarians consistently praise our medical standards. From routine care to advanced treatments, each dog receives personalized attention. Hard costs for a healthy dog range from $804-$920; heartworm-positive dogs or those needing specialized care can exceed $2,000+. Adoption fees help cover a portion of these expenses, but without government funding, we rely on fundraising to bridge the gap—ranging from $100–$1,000+ per dog.
